VALL DE CARDÓS
Official blazon
Escut caironat: d'atzur, una vall d'argent sobremuntada d'un card de tres flors d'or. Per timbre, una corona mural de vila.
Origin/meaning
These arms have been officially granted on 25th September 2001.
This Pyrenean municipality was formed in 1971 with the previous ones of Ribera de Cardós, the chief town, and Estaon. The arms are canting: they show a golden thistle ("card" in Catalan) above the valley of Cardós.
